Re: Retirement of the Stonebriar product line

Stonebriar sales have declined for five consecutive quarters and support costs now exceed contribution margin. The retirement plan is staged: new orders close end of Q2, existing contracts honoured through their terms, and spares stocked for twenty-four months. Sales leads should steer prospects toward the Ashgrove range; migration incentives are already approved. Customer comms are drafted and awaiting legal sign-off. The forward strategy behind this decision is set out in the note below.

confidential, yafog-hagug: Gross margin on Druix came in at 10 percent against a plan of 15 percent. Only 5 of the 80 pilot accounts renewed Druix, so a churn review is set for October 1.

### Vendoring Third-Party Fonts

Heads up: the Brindlewick build no longer pulls fonts from the public mirror at release time. Instead, vendor them into `assets/fonts/` via the `fontgrab` tool before cutting the branch. Run `fontgrab sync --manifest fonts.lock`, eyeball the diff (licenses live in `NOTICES.md`), and commit. If a font fails its checksum, bump the lockfile rather than hand-editing. The tool talks to our internal Glyphcache service, so you'll need to authenticate first with the key below.

API key for tagef-fafop: vxb2-ta

# Pinchworth recipe-scaling calculator — release settings.
# Scaling ratios are computed server-side; do not override
# `ratio_precision` below 4 or batch conversions will drift.
# The unit table ships with each release; regenerate via
# `pinch build-units` before tagging. Feature flags for the
# metric/imperial toggle live in `flags.toml`, not here.
# Release manager: confirm the staging smoke tests pass
# before promoting. The calculator reads conversion data
# from the database reachable at the connection string below.

primary connection of yagep-kahip = redis://giliel_svc:zYiKsLL2PLpfPL@db-348f.xolmarsys.corp:5432/fenwyn